Questions, answered.
- What is Hannon Armstrong Sustainable Infrastructure Capital's payments received on financing receivables?
- Hannon Armstrong Sustainable Infrastructure Capital (HASI) reported payments received on financing receivables of $244.29M in Q1 2026.
- How has Hannon Armstrong Sustainable Infrastructure Capital's payments received on financing receivables changed year-over-year?
- Hannon Armstrong Sustainable Infrastructure Capital's payments received on financing receivables increased by 503.9% year-over-year, from $40.46M to $244.29M.
- What is the long-term trend for Hannon Armstrong Sustainable Infrastructure Capital's payments received on financing receivables?
-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Hannon Armstrong Sustainable Infrastructure Capital's payments received on financing receivables has grown at a 47.6%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$148.77M to $705.68M.
- What does payments received on financing receivables mean?
- This metric measures the cash inflows resulting from the principal repayment of loans and financing receivables held by the company. It serves as a primary indicator of the recurring cash-generating capacity of the company's core lending business. Consistent collections demonstrate the credit quality and stability of the underlying project portfolio.
